Transaction 1bbdbf93886403a86ce3741cbb605911c8858fc913be191f30691904e00c7ce3
1 Input
1 Output
-
1bbdbf93886403a86ce3741cbb605911c8858fc913be191f30691904e00c7ce3:0
- value
- 93637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c501e5a4b35b3ca66af6b1556875e3d60d6c71f OP_EQUAL
- address
- 3A784vku5HVy7sx3xxFkuViBTKBr4pM666